stagecoach and hartlepool council have come too a temporary agreement to re install a sunday service on the number 1 bus route running from hartlepool too middlesbrough and back again meaning non drivers will now have a chance too get too and from rspb saltholme on sundays

it is a trial on a 'use it or lose it' basis  and starts on the 11th of november and hopefully will continue for people like myself without a car as the bus stop is handily right outside the main gates of the reserve.

hi dave

im not sure who ringed the bird but there is a website that gives all the contact details of who to report colour ringed birds too.

http://www.cr-birding.be/

you click on species and colour of ring too obtain the correct person to contact via email however im not sure how up to date the website is as when i got a reply it was from another person who had my email forwarded too him with a note saying that the person listed on the website emigrated too australia some years ago !

for those interested i thought id share the information i just got back from reporting the colour ringed mute swan that was in jacksons landing late november below is the email


SKU was ringed as a female cygnet at Studley Royal Park on the 31st of August 2003. Yours is the first re-sighting of the bird since that time so is of particular interest.
